Game Information:

Heavy Nova is a video game for the Sega Mega-CD, Sega Mega Drive/Genesis, and Sharp X68000 that combines elements of fighting games with platform games and mission elements. It was released in 1991 and distributed to Japan and the United States and quickly became known as kusoge. Players assume the role of a robot operator destined to earn the highest operator rank. To do so, the robot – known in the game as a Heavy DOLL – must complete a combat training camp which prompts the 2D Platformer stages. The player then must combat other Heavy DOLLs as the end-level bosses which prompts the 2D fighting elements.
